Guinness Nigeria Plc, a subsidiary of Diageo Plc, has opened its new state-of-the-art headquarters, a modern space designed to resonate the company’s mission – ‘celebrating life, every day everywhere’ – in Ogba, Lagos.

The opening, which coincided with its 72nd anniversary, was part of efforts of the organisation to develop newer and more strategic ways of working, enhancing collaboration and productivity, promoting creativity and sustaining its business operations.

During the ceremony, Board Chair, Guinness Nigeria, Dr. Omobola Johnson, said the new headquarters would create an environment where all employees and other stakeholders feel included and able to perform at their best.

“We recognise our employees’ needs, especially after working remotely for so long. So, we have created a modern and agile workspace designed for maximum connectivity, collaboration and connection in line with the new world of work,” Johnson said.

The Managing Director, Baker Magunda, revealed that the initiative reaffirmed the company’s commitment to its drive towards sustaining its long-term business goals in the country.
